Output ddbf97fdf0eb49c2fa975cfbd5301eaa19dea3702ca4de239a9a5159b4ae403e:0

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4769680d8f0dd5090a70724e6a1a99a42ff567e2 OP_EQUAL
address
38CcAw3xzksWTmKku1eBUFRk9Xyw1ixL47
transaction
ddbf97fdf0eb49c2fa975cfbd5301eaa19dea3702ca4de239a9a5159b4ae403e
confirmations
325054
spent
true